This commit is contained in:
2023-12-22 16:01:11 +01:00
parent 137c5a89dd
commit 369c0ae21d
5 changed files with 659 additions and 337 deletions

View File

@@ -1,23 +1,23 @@
import numpy as np
import matplotlib.pyplot as plt
import matplotlib
from matplotlib.animation import FuncAnimation
import ast
def plot():
with open("data/probability_deviation.txt") as f:
lines = f.readlines();
x = []
arr_narrow = []
arr_wide = []
for line in lines:
tmp = line.strip().split(",")
x.append(float(tmp[0]))
arr_narrow.append(float(tmp[1]))
arr_wide.append(float(tmp[2]))
files = [
"data/probability_deviation_no_slits.txt",
"data/probability_deviation_slits.txt",
]
for file in files:
with open(file) as f:
lines = f.readlines();
x = []
arr = []
for line in lines:
tmp = line.strip().split("\t")
x.append(float(tmp[0]))
arr.append(float(tmp[1]))
plt.plot(x,arr)
plt.plot(x,arr_narrow)
plt.plot(x,arr_wide)
plt.savefig("latex/images/probability_deviation.pdf")
if __name__ == "__main__":